Core Functional Differences

Shelving focuses on small items and carton picks. They support lighter loads and provide easy access for frequent picking. Typically, they have solid or wire decks, with depths under 30 inches, making them perfect for manual workflows.

Racking systems, on the other hand, are built to handle pallet loads and are accessed using forklifts or pallet jacks. Expect deeper bays (>30 inches) and floor anchoring. Load transfer is through beams to uprights, making decking choices and section ratings critical for safety.

Load ratings vary a lot. Reinforced shelving supports up to 2,000 lbs/shelf. Racking supports 1,000+ lbs per pallet and multi-pallet stacking. Wire mesh decking can carry thousands of pounds per section, while solid and perforated steel offer even higher capacities.

Operational Impact

Space use is crucial. Many facilities in Singapore underutilize vertical space. Racking systems unlock this vertical volume, increasing usable space per square foot. This extra density can offset the higher initial costs.

Your choice also affects workflow and productivity. Shelving units are ideal for fast manual picking and retail displays. Selective/flow racking can cut forklift travel and improve throughput.

Safety and compliance vary by system. Expect inspections, bolt checks, guarding, and standards compliance for racking. Shelving requires basic checks/anchoring; always follow maker guidance for both systems.

Cost considerations are practical. Shelving is cheaper to install and fine for lower density. Racking costs more upfront but can deliver better long-term ROI via vertical density, better workflow, and efficiency.

Types of Racking Systems for High-Capacity Storage

The right racking system can strongly enhance performance. We cover pallet-rack formats, specialty racks, and key design/safety factors for Singapore.

Core Pallet Rack Types

Selective pallet racking ensures 100% direct access to each pallet. It facilitates simple picking for mixed SKUs and offers clear inventory visibility in storage racks.

High-density push-back/drive-in designs optimise aisle use. Push-back uses inclined carts for LIFO. Drive-in racks store pallets deep on rails, enabling dense stacking.

Pallet flow uses rollers for FIFO, ideal for perishables and rotation needs. Choose single- or multi-deep per throughput and SKU variety.

Racks for Unique Loads

Cantilever racks are designed for long, bulky items such as timber and steel profiles. They conserve floor area and make loading easier.

Bar/sheet/drum/cylinder racks fit specific geometries. Food-service dunnage racks (plastic/aluminum/wire) meet hygiene/weight needs.

Carton-flow and bin racks boost picking efficiency. Roller-based carton flow supports FIFO. Cylinder/drum racks add retention for gases/hazard liquids to maintain compliance.

Racking Safety & Design

Use baseplates, spacers, and ties to anchor tall frames for stability. Proper anchoring minimizes sway and collapse risks in high commercial racking.

Choose decking based on load and handling method. Wire mesh enables airflow and reduces drop-through risk. Perforated and solid steel decks support heavier loads and machine handling.

Implement inspection routines and adhere to industry standards like ANSI MH16.1 for selective racking. Perform bolt torque checks, inspect welds, and install guards and bollards to protect uprights from forklifts.

Label bay/beam capacities to prevent overloads. Beam and upright choices determine bay load and pallet placement. Operator training, aisle planning, and routing help meet Singapore codes.

Costs, Space & ROI

Focus on upfront costs, vertical utilisation, and ROI when choosing. Accurate figures and real outcomes guide planning in Singapore and dense regions.

Initial and ongoing cost factors

Shelving is usually $100–$500/unit for boltless/light-duty options. Racks cost about $300–$1,500+ per bay, based on spec.

Installation adds to total spend. Shelving is commonly DIY, lowering labour. Racks often require pros, lift equipment, and special decking. Additional costs include accessories like pallet supports, decking, and protective guards, which increase the total cost of racking and storage solutions.

Upkeep varies. Shelves typically need light visual maintenance. Racks require inspections, retorquing, upright fixes, and audits. Such recurring spend affects TCO/ROI long-term.

Space efficiency and productivity impacts

Without proper planning, layouts often utilize only 22–35% of vertical space. Racks increase vertical utilisation and reduce wasted space. This results in better space utilization compared to free-standing shelving units.

Efficiency rises when layout matches inventory and handling patterns. Selective or pallet flow can cut travel/pick time ~15–25%, improving throughput and reducing wear. Such productivity strengthens value per square foot.

When evaluating shelving cost against spatial benefits, racking generally offers higher density despite a higher initial investment. That’s vital when floor space is tight and vertical growth is the goal.
